Fort Valley State University vs. Central State University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, Fort Valley State University or Central State University?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Fort Valley State University than Central State University ($10,047 vs. $11,398).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Fort Valley State University are 7.7% lower than at Central State University ($11,100 vs. $12,026).
- Central State University is 45.8% more expensive for in-state tuition than Fort Valley State University (about $2,532 more per year; $8,058.00 vs. $5,526.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 68.3% higher at Fort Valley State University than at Central State University (about $6,874 more per year; $16,932.00 vs. $10,058.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at Central State University than at Fort Valley State University (99% vs. 94%).
- The average total grant financial aid received by Central State University students is 85.6% larger than aid received by Fort Valley State University students ($18,654 vs. $10,049).
Fort Valley State University vs. Central State University Admissions comparison
Which college is harder to get into, Fort Valley State University or Central State University? Typical SAT and ACT scores (same estimates as in the table above), middle 50% test ranges where reported, test score submission policy, deadlines, and acceptance rates summarize admission difficulty between Central State University and Fort Valley State University.
- The typical SAT score (median estimate) at Fort Valley State University (1000) is 140 points higher than at Central State University (860).
- Incoming Fort Valley State University students have a 5 point higher typical ACT composite (median estimate) (21 vs. 16 at Central State University).
- Reported middle 50% SAT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Fort Valley State University 930/1070; Central State University 770/950.
- Reported middle 50% ACT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Fort Valley State University 19/24; Central State University 14/18.
- Submitting SAT or ACT scores: Fort Valley State University - Test optional; Central State University - Test-free.
- Typical fall application deadline: Fort Valley State University Jun 15, 2027.
- Accepted freshman Fort Valley State University students have a 0.07 point higher average high school GPA (2.87) than students at Central State University (2.8).
- Central State University has a higher acceptance rate (98.6%) than Fort Valley State University (65.9%).
- The share of admitted students who enrolled (yield) is 22.8% at Fort Valley State University vs. 19.4% at Central State University.
Fort Valley State University vs. Central State University Graduation Outcomes Comparison
How do outcomes compare for Fort Valley State University and Central State University?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).
- Fort Valley State University's six-year graduation rate (33%) is higher than Central State University's (24%).
- Graduates from Fort Valley State University earn a median of about $4,800 more per year than Central State University graduates about ten years after starting college ($32,000 vs. $27,200),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
- Among federal student loan borrowers, Fort Valley State University graduates have a $2,500 lower median loan debt than Central State University graduates ($36,500 vs. $39,000).
- Among borrowers, Fort Valley State University graduates have an estimated $26 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than Central State University graduates ($377 vs. $403).
- More Fort Valley State University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Central State University students, three years after graduation. (19% vs. 16%)
Sources: U.S. Department of Education https://nces.ed.gov IPEDS and College Scorecard https://collegescorecard.ed.gov/. Values reflect the most recent year available in our dataset.
